1. The Town does hereby agree to hire the Instructor as an independent
contractor, and the Instructor does hereby agree to provide instructional services
to the Town for the program(s) hereinafter described, subject to the terms and
conditions hereinafter set forth.
2. ' ' The Instructor shall provide instructional services . for the following
program, to wit:
Defensive Driving
3. The Instructor hereby agrees to commence the rendering of services on
March 16, 2019 and to render instructional services during the
following time period:
3/16/19
Saturday 9:00 a.m. - 3:30 p.m.
Location: Recreation Center
4. The Town agrees to compensate the instructor for satisfactory
performance as described herein in the amount of $30/person after services are
rendered and voucher is completed.
5. It is agreed that the Instructor shall report to the Supervisor for the
Recreation Department of the Town. The Instructor shall determine that scope
and manner of work to be performed and the hours for which it will be performed.
6. It is agreed that the Instructor shall-be responsible for the-establishment of
the program, to assist with ,the solicitation_of participants therein, and the
completion of all the classes planned for-such program.
7. In the event of the temporary illness, inability of the Instructor to conduct
classes as and when scheduled, or cancellation due to inclement weather, the
Instructor shall immediately notify the Recreation, Department. The Instructor will
assist and/or cooperate with the supervisor to contact all participants notifying
them of the class cancellation and to provide for makeup classes.
8. In the event that the enrollment in the program is, less than the minimum
enrollment as hereinafter set forth, the Town shall have the right to terminate this
agreement. In the event that the Instructor fails or neglects to perform such
instructional services in accordance with provisions of this agreement, then and
in such event, the Town in the exercise of discretion, shall have the right to
terminate this agreement.
9. The-minimum and maximum enrollment of the class for the program is as
follows: Minimum Enrollment 12 Maximum Enrollment 40
10. The Instructor agrees to prepare accurate attendance records of all
persons enrolled in the program and to file the same with the Recreation
Supervisor within one week after the last class of the program.
11. The Instructor represents that he or she is competent by reason of training
and experience to provide the instruction provided for in this contract, and will
provide such services in a competent and professional manner. The Instructor
represents and agrees that he or she is an independent contractor and is solely
responsible for payment of taxes arising out of this employment. The Instructor
agrees that he or she is an independent contractor and that the Town of Southold
shall not be liable for any taxes or withholding. There shall be no fringe benefits
associated with this Agreement. There shall be no health benefits offered to the
Instructor. There shall be no workers compensation benefits offered to the
Instructor. The,Instructor is expected to utilize his/her independent judgment in
fulfilling his/her Instructor tasks.
12. The Instructor will not receive payment for any services rendered until this
contract is signed and returned to the town clerk's office prior to the beginning of
said program.
13. The Town of Southold shall, as part of the Instructor's compensation,
cover the individual Instructor from claims for bodily injury, death or property
damage which may arise from the performance of his/her services under the
Agreement in limits of $1,000,000. and $2,000,000 aggregate liability'for bodily
injury and property damage. This coverage does not inure any other benefits
upon the independent contractor nor does it alter or modify the Instructor's status
as an independent contractor.
